NVIDIA Tesla K20c vs NVIDIA Quadro M600M
NVIDIA Tesla K20c vs NVIDIA Quadro M600M
VS
NVIDIA Tesla K20c
NVIDIA Quadro M600M
We compared two Professional market GPUs: 5GB VRAM Tesla K20c and 2GB VRAM Quadro M600M to see which GPU has better performance in key specifications, benchmark tests, power consumption, etc.
Main Differences
NVIDIA Tesla K20c 's Advantages
More VRAM (5GB vs 2GB)
Larger VRAM bandwidth (208.0GB/s vs 80.19GB/s)
2112 additional rendering cores
NVIDIA Quadro M600M 's Advantages
Released 2 years and 9 months late
Boost Clock876MHz
Lower TDP (30W vs 225W)
